Bob wrote:

yep...saw a movie..an old one starring montgomery clift. the
credits said everyone in the movie apart from clift was active
duty military...it was about the berlin airlift.

as one of the planes comes into the airport, the controller asked
him to 'qsy' to another freq. was amazed...


In the 60's movie "Them" about giant ants
that attacked New Mexico, the cops, supposed
to be NM State Police used KMA628 for their
callsign.

Not radio related, but on some of the old "Flipper"
TV shows, the coast guard helicopter winch guy
had a helmet that read "NAVY".

And speaking of Flipper, what kind of callsign
is WD9598, that Ranger Ricks used to say on his radio?
